How to make overnight sourdough pancakes

  • Start by mixing sourdough starter, milk, cake flour and sugar. Cover and let sit overnight.
  • In the morning, add butter, salt, baking powder, vanilla and egg yolks.
  • Then, whip the egg whites to just firm peaks and fold them in.
  • Spoon some batter into the buttered hot wells and top with strawberries.
  • Finally, cook and turn until the pancakes are golden brown.

Can aebelskivers be made ahead?

Yes, they can be made ahead and frozen. Rewarm in the oven

What is the best aebelskiver pan?

I prefer a non-stick pan

What can I serve with aebelskivers?

Any of your favorite fresh fruits and syrups

Can I make these pancakes without a specialty pan?

Absolutely. Use a flat top griddle to make the standard flapjacks.

Sourdough Pancakes

Lisa Keys
One of my favorite uses of sourdough discard this recipe starts the night before and finishes in the morning.

Prep Time 15 minutes mins
Cook Time 8 minutes mins
Total Time 23 minutes mins
Course Brunch
Cuisine American
Servings 6
Calories 148 kcal

Ingredients
  

  • 3 oz. (62.5 g) sourdough starter or discard
  • ¾ cup (184) g milk
  • 2 teaspoons sugar
  • ¾ cup (109 g) cake flour
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ted plus extra for greasing pan
  • ¼ teaspoon fine sea salt
  • ½ teaspoon baking powder
  • ½ teaspoon vanilla
  • 2 eggs, separated
  • ½ cup diced strawberries, plus 10 strawberries, sliced
  • Whipped Cream
  • Maple syrup
  • Powdered sugar

Instructions
 

  • The night before, in a medium-sized mixing bowl, whisk sourdough starter, milk, sugar and cake flour until blended. Cover and set aside on counter overnight.
  • In the morning, stir in melted butter, salt, baking powder, vanilla and egg yolks.
  • Whip egg whites to just stiff peaks. Using a rubber spatula, fold egg whites into batter.
  • Brush the wells of an ebelskiver pan with butter and place over medium heat. When the bubbling of the butter subsides, spoon 1 tablespoon of batter into each well.
  • Spoon 1 teaspoon of diced strawberries into the center of each pancake. Top each with enough batter to fill the well. Cook the pancakes for 3 to 5 minutes or until bottoms are golden brown and crisp.
  • Use two wooden chopsticks or skewers to turn pancakes. Cook 2 to 3 minutes more or until lightly brown.
  • Repeat with remaining ingredients keeping cooked pancakes warm in a 200F oven.
  • To serve, arrange warm pancakes on individual serving plates and top with sliced strawberries, whipped cream, maple syrup and a dusting of powdered sugar, if desired.
